How to complete review when Non-resident state form is done manually

Full time resident of MO.  Had some income tax withheld for IL. So I manually did the Illinois 1040 and NR forms and selected MO for my state tax for in Turbo tax Premier

 

My problem is that since I did not buy an addition state (of Illinois non-resident file) and entered the information manually in turbo tax MO state form to get the credit,  the complete review process keeps looping through saying I need to complete my tax filings by buying the IL state form.  

I don't need or want to buy the additional state.  I just want turbo tax to complete the review process for the Fed and MO state return and proceed to print and file.

Windows desktop allows you to see the MO form and enter the credits from the other state. However, I don't understand how you are going to efile MO since the MO CR needs to be a part of your return and the other state return must be attached to the CR. You would need to mail the MO or efile the other state.

@olgoat I do not see your looping issue in TurboTax Download\CD Premier. You may be seeing this because you told TurboTax in Personal Info that you made money in another state (Illinois).

  • Click on Personal Info
  • On Your and Your Family go down to the bottom to Other State Income. If Illinois is listed, Edit, and say No, I didn't make money in any other states.
  • Select File in the upper left. 
  • Click Remove State and remove Illinois if it's there.

If you are still seeing a looping issue, you can ignore it. You can print and mail by clicking on Print Center in the upper right.

 

To check your Illinois credit, click Forms in the upper right. In the left column find Form MO-CR(1). Double click and the form will open.
